Default Unexpected Attention

I bought my first C5 3 weeks ago - with no intentions of impressing anyone except myself. And I am impressed - the more I drive it the more I love it!! So anyway, here's what happened today:

I don't normally take the Vette to the grocery store, but after a pleasure cruise I stopped to pick up one item needed for supper tonight. As I was making my 2nd lap around the parking lot, looking for just the "right" stall, I realized I was being followed by an attractive woman in a newer Cadillac. I decided she must just be a careful parker, looking for an ideal spot like me. I pulled into a spot, got out of the car and saw that she had stopped directly behind me, blocking the aisle, and postioning her car in my intended path. I knew I hadn't committed any driving offenses against her, so I was unsure of her intentions as I walked towards the Caddy. Down comes the passenger side window, and she smiles as she begins to speak. I bend down to hear what she's saying. She informs me that she followed me into and around the lot just to compliment me on the Vette! Totally taken aback, (I've only had the car 3 weeks), I am only able to smile and say "Thanks" as she rolls away, raising the window. WOW!!! I'm not sure if she knew it or not, but she made my day..... Maybe even my week!! I must have had the silliest smile as I floated around the store, thinking back to my youth, when part of the purpose of a car was to impress the ladies... it's been a loooong time. So now I'm thinkin "Yeah, buying this car was really a good idea". A fringe benefit that I had not even considered, but I guess I can live with it.....
